Assessing recent performance and context for Dow (DOW)

With no single headline event setting the tone, Dow (DOW) is drawing attention for its recent trading performance, including a negative 1 day move and declines over the past week, alongside gains over the past month and past 3 months.

At a share price of $31.42, Dow’s recent 30 day share price return of 13.96% and 90 day share price return of 47.44% contrast with a 1 year total shareholder return decline of 14.98%. This suggests that short term momentum is strengthening, while longer term performance remains weaker.

Most Popular Narrative: 13% Overvalued

Dow’s narrative fair value of $27.81 sits below the last close at $31.42, setting up a gap that hinges on how future earnings power is assessed.

Dow is targeting at least $1 billion in annual cost reductions by 2026, focusing on areas such as purchased services and contract labor. These cost-cutting measures aim to improve net margins and bolster earnings despite a challenging macroeconomic environment.

However, the story could shift quickly if elevated feedstock and energy costs persist, or if prolonged macro weakness keeps demand and pricing under pressure.

Another Take on Valuation: Sales Multiple Paints a Cheaper Picture

That narrative fair value of $27.81 suggests Dow might be 13% overvalued, but the current P/S of 0.6x looks low next to both peers at 0.8x and the Chemicals industry at 1.2x. With a fair ratio of 0.9x, is the market being too cautious on Dow’s revenue base?
